Maintaining Refrigeration Equipment: Best Practices

Regular upkeep of refrigeration units is critical for guaranteeing peak performance and extending its lifespan . Best practices involve routine washing of coils and condensers to reduce frost and boost heat transfer . Furthermore, regular inspections of refrigerant levels , refrigeration unit health, and power circuits are absolutely necessary . Proper lubrication of mechanical components and prompt repair of any leaks will significantly minimize the risk of costly failures and improve power effectiveness .

Freezer Room Insulation: Boosting Energy Reduction

Proper climate control for your freezer room is critical to minimizing operational costs and maintaining product integrity. Poor insulation allows for considerable heat gain , forcing your freezing system to work overtime , squandering energy. Consider employing a high-performance barrier like polyurethane panels , paying particular regard to air-gapping gaps around access points and pathways for conduits . Regular inspections and upkeep of your thermal barrier can increase its operational time and confirm continued operational efficiency .
